About the Role
Our client, a leading provider of industrial automation solutions, is seeking a dedicated Field Service Engineer to support their operations in and around Klerksdorp. In this critical role, you will be responsible for the installation, maintenance, and repair of complex automation systems at client sites. Your expertise will be vital in ensuring maximum uptime and performance of automated machinery and processes.
This is a hands-on, customer-facing position requiring significant travel within the region, offering the chance to work with cutting-edge technology and build strong client relationships within various industrial sectors.
- Install, commission, and service industrial automation equipment, including robotics, PLCs, and HMI systems.
- Perform preventative maintenance, diagnostics, and troubleshooting to identify and resolve technical issues promptly.
- Provide on-site technical support and training to clients on the operation and maintenance of equipment.
- Document service activities, including detailed reports on repairs, maintenance, and client interactions.
- Collaborate with the internal engineering and sales teams to ensure customer satisfaction and identify opportunities for system upgrades.
- Adhere to strict safety protocols and environmental regulations at all client sites.
- Diploma or Bach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ering, Mechatronics, or a related technical field.
- Minimum of 4 years of experience as a Field Service Engineer or in a similar technical support role.
- Strong hands-on experience with industrial automation systems, PLC programming (e.g., Siemens, Allen-Bradley), and robotics.
- Proficiency in reading electrical schematics, P&IDs, and mechanical drawings.
- Excellent customer service, communication, and problem-solving skills.
- Willingness to travel extensively within the assigned territory and occasionally internationally.
